C# xamarin.android visual studio 2015中电子邮件地址验证的编码?
在xamarin.android visual studio 2015中使用C#进行电子邮件地址验证的编码是什么?请告诉我是否需要任何名称空间?请告诉我所有imp步骤以及edittext中电子邮件地址验证的编码。C# xamarin.android visual studio 2015中电子邮件地址验证的编码?,c#,visual-studio-2015,xamarin.android,email-address,C#,Visual Studio 2015,Xamarin.android,Email Address,在xamarin.android visual studio 2015中使用C#进行电子邮件地址验证的编码是什么?请告诉我是否需要任何名称空间?请告诉我所有imp步骤以及edittext中电子邮件地址验证的编码。 我是安卓新手,xamarin。。伙计们,请帮帮我,你可以使用Regex进行电子邮件验证 首先添加下面的using语句 using System.Text.RegularExpressions; 然后使用以下辅助方法进行验证: Regex EmailRegex = new Regex
我是安卓新手,xamarin。。伙计们,请帮帮我,你可以使用Regex进行电子邮件验证 首先添加下面的using语句
using System.Text.RegularExpressions;
然后使用以下辅助方法进行验证:
Regex EmailRegex = new Regex (@"^([\w\.\-]+)@([\w\-]+)((\.(\w){2,3})+)$");
public bool ValidateEmail(string email)
{
if (string.IsNullOrWhiteSpace(email))
return false;
return EmailRegex.IsMatch(email);
}
选项2:
Xamarin.Android
有一个用于电子邮件验证的助手方法,您也可以使用该方法:
Android.Util.Patterns.EmailAddress.Matcher(email).Matches();
先生,谢谢您的代表。但当我尝试此代码时,请给我一个错误列表,它们如下所示:1`修饰符'readonly'对此项App12无效,找不到类型或命名空间名称'Regex'(您是否缺少using指令或程序集引用?)3,找不到类型或命名空间名称'Regex'(您是否缺少using指令或程序集引用?`Remove
readonly
修饰符,并在文件顶部添加以下using语句:using System.Text.RegularExpressions;
先生,我为该函数创建了一个新类。您能告诉我如何在if()中调用该函数到我的注册活动中吗
condition如果您首先在新类中添加了它,那么您需要将该函数ValidateEmail
和EmailRegex
标记为static
。然后您可以将其用作YourClass.ValidateEmail(someTextField.Text)
id此编码{if(mtxtemeric.Text==emailaddressvalidateemail(string email)){}
是否正确?